Google
ALLIMAGESVIDEOSBOOKS
cardiidae acanthocardiabivalvia cardiidaegenus acanthocardiaacanthocardia tubercolataacanthocardia speciesacanthocardia aculeataacanthocardia tuberculatumbivalve molluscfossiles bivalviainaturalist
Next >

Ohio - From your IP address - Learn more
Sign in
SettingsPrivacyTerms